Classic Cheesy Lasagna

Classic Cheesy Lasagna is a hearty and comforting layered pasta dish featuring rich meat sauce, creamy cheese mixtures, and perfectly cooked noodles, baked to golden perfection.

Ingredients

Units Scale
  • 12 lasagna noodles
  • 1 lb ground beef or sausage
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ups tomato sauce or crushed tomatoes
  • 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 1/2 cups ricotta cheese or cottage cheese
  • 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Instructions

  1. Boil lasagna noodles until al dente according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
  2. In a pan, heat olive oil over medium heat. Sauté onions and garlic until fragrant.
  3. Add ground beef or sausage and cook until browned. Drain excess fat if needed.
  4. Stir in tomato sauce, tomato paste,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Simmer for 20 minutes.
  5. In a bowl, mix ricotta cheese, egg, Parmesan cheese,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  6.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  7. In a 9×13-inch baking dish, layer noodles, meat sauce, ricotta mixture, and mozzarella cheese. Repeat layers, finishing with mozzarella and Parmesan on top.
  8. Cover with foil and bake for 25 minutes. Remove foil and bake another 15 minutes until bubbly and golden.
  9. Let lasagna rest for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• Use no-boil noodles for quicker prep.
  • Letting the lasagna rest helps layers set for cleaner slicing.
  • Customize the filling with vegetables or different cheeses.
  • Freeze portions for convenient meals later.
  • Add fresh herbs like basil or parsley for extra flavor.
